WebSep 3, 2024 · Buckwheat Despite the name buckwheat is a seed and does not contain any wheat. Nutritionally dense, it is high in protein, fibre, iron, zinc, selenium and B vitamins plus it can also aid digestion. Buckwheat has an earthy flavour and soft starchy texture so it’s perfect in breads and pancakes. WebBuckwheat has been considered a functional health-improving pseudocereal grain throughout large areas of Eurasia, North America, South Africa, and Australia. Buckwheat is generally classified into common and Tartary buckwheat. Common buckwheat is self-incompatible while Tartary buckwheat is capable of self-pollination to some extent. WebDespite its name, buckwheat contains no gluten, so it's a great alternative to regular flour in pastas, noodles, pancakes and baked goods. The hulled kernels, known as kasha, are also enjoyed ...

WebIt grows so quickly, in fact, that you can fit two crops of this annual plant into one summer if you have an especially weedy area that you want to “herbicide” in a friendly way. To grow buckwheat, broadcast a cup of seed over 100 square feet (or 1 pound per 300 to 500 square feet; or 60 to 80 pounds per acre) and rake it in about an inch deep.
